Many people who transport children in cars do not understand how airbags work. They fail to fully appreciate the threat passenger-sid- e airbags pose to young children and to realize why they must take steps to protect children up to 1 2 years of age. Thebottom line: children and airbags do not mix. Airbags could seriously injure or evenkill children w ho are in the front scat. In addition, short stature adults are also at risk when positioned too close to the airbag module, especially when unbuckled. There have been over 20,000 airbag deployments in which the driver was under five feet tall. In these cases, there have been nine fatalities, all of whom were positioned too close to the air bag or unbelted. Air bag risk is minimal if a driver can 2 inches or more away from sit tire steering wheel. Air bags are a supplemental restraint device which means simply that it is to work in conjunction with lap and shoulder belts to protect you in a vehicle crash. If the maiket value listed on your notice is higher than w hat you think our property would sell for, you should appeal to the board of equalization w itliin 30 days or by the date on the notice. Step 1 : Obtain a copy of your property tax file from the county assessor and check it for errors. Make sure the property description is accurate. Sec that the acreage of the lot and square footage of the building are accurate. Verify the number of rooms and an unfinished space in the bui Iding. Errors w Inch v ould inflate the value of the property should be identified in your appeal. Step 2: Substantiate the value of your property. This can be done w ith real estate closing papers, a professional appraisal, or value or recent sales of comparable property obtained through realtor. Many realtors are willing to provide a computer listing of property sales at no cost in hopes of getting your future business. Those who have had their mortgages refinanced recently can submit that appraisal with their appeal. Step 3: Submit any errors found during Step One. and the value established in StepTwo along with yourappeal to theboard of equalization within tire time period indicated on the notice. In larger counties, you w ill be notified of a specificdateand timeforyour appeal aftcryou submit yourrequest. In smaller counties, your appeal may be heard at the same time your request is made. Some counties allow' taxpayers to mail their appeals and some of these may be decided w ithout a formal hearing. Step 4: The Hearing: There w ill be three parlies at the hearing; a representative of the county assessor, a neutral arbitrator appointed by the county, and you or someone you select to represent you. It is up to you to show w hy your property is not worth what the assessor sas it is worth. This is not the time to complain about high taxes. The only appropriate matter to be considered is the value of your property. Tire assessors representative shows w hy he feels the property is w orth w hat is shown on the notice. You will have tire opportunity to ask questions or make comments about tire assessors information. Step 5: If you are unhappy with the decision of theboard of equalization, you may appeal to the State Tax Commission. How ever, you ha e only 30 da s to make the appeal. The Tax Commission w ill review the record of tire hearing, including information and findings of the board of equalization. As a general rule, taxpayers will not be able to induce new evidence to the Tax Commission. Step 6: If you are not satisfied will) the decision by the Tax Commission, you may appeal through tire courts. Thank You!
